Capitol Federal Financial
CFFN
CFFN
252 hedge funds and large institutions have $725M invested in Capitol Federal Financial in 2026 Q1 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 32 funds opening new positions, 86 increasing their positions, 78 reducing their positions, and 31 closing their positions.
